Morph
Image morphing is a useful visualization technique. Morphing is an image processing technique used to compute a transformation from one image to another. The process is called "morph" for short. The idea is to create a sequence of intermediate images. When putting these intermediate images together with the original images, it represents the transition from one image to the other.

Note: Morphing between two images achieves the best results if the images are roughly of the same shape and size.
